
Electrical and electronic repairers are in high demand due to the increasing complexity of automated electronic control systems. They are responsible for installing, repairing, and maintaining electronic equipment, including household appliances, computers, phones, and large-scale laboratory equipment. To become an electrical and electronic repairer, one must possess a strong understanding of electronics, circuitry, and electricity. In addition, repairers must be able to identify colour-coded components and use software and testing equipment to diagnose malfunctions. Most employers seek entry-level technicians with an associate's degree in electronics or a related field, and some job experience.

Education and experience: An associate's degree in electronics or a related field is often required
To become an electrical and electronic repairer, you will need a strong educational background in electronics and related fields. Most employers seek entry-level technicians with an associate's degree in electronics or a related subject area. This could include an associate's degree in electronic systems, appliance services, or basic electronics.
Community colleges and technical colleges often offer these types of associate's degree programs, providing you with the necessary knowledge and skills to enter the field. The ISCET (International Society of Certified Electronics Technicians), for example, offers certification in a broad range of topics, including electronics, electronic systems, and appliance services. Obtaining certification typically involves meeting prerequisites and passing a comprehensive exam.
In addition to formal education, having hands-on experience in repairing and maintaining electronic equipment is highly valuable. This could be gained through internships, apprenticeships, or personal projects. Some repairers may also have previous experience in electrical engineering or a similar field, which can provide a strong foundation for a career in electrical and electronic repair.
It is also important to develop a broad skill set that can be applied to various industries. Electrical and electronic repairers work in a variety of sectors, including manufacturing, transportation, and laboratory settings. Each industry has its own unique set of equipment and systems, so adaptability and a willingness to learn are essential.
Overall, a combination of an associate's degree, relevant certifications, and hands-on experience will provide a strong foundation for a career as an electrical and electronic repairer.

Job duties: Install, repair, and maintain electrical equipment and electronics
Electrical and electronics installers and repairers are responsible for installing, repairing, and maintaining a wide range of electrical and electronic equipment. They work with complex systems and machinery, ensuring they function optimally and adhere to specifications.
These technicians often begin by inspecting and testing equipment to identify any issues. They use a range of tools, from hand tools like screwdrivers and wrenches to advanced testing equipment and software. Multimeters, for instance, are commonly used to measure voltage, current, and resistance, while advanced multimeters can measure capacitance, inductance, and current gain of transistors. They also use signal generators and oscilloscopes to provide and display test signals graphically.
In manufacturing plants, they work with assembly line motors, while in transportation systems, they maintain sonar systems, mobile communication equipment, and security and navigation systems. They may also work with digital audio and video players, passive and active security systems, and electronic control systems.
Additionally, electrical and electronics installers and repairers may specialise in specific areas, such as electric motors, power tools, and related equipment. They could become armature winders, generator mechanics, or even electric golf cart repairers. Some repairers work specifically with transportation equipment, including trains, watercraft, and other vehicles, while others focus on motor vehicles, such as cars.
They may work for a company or operate their own repair service, and most employers seek entry-level technicians with an associate's degree in electronics or a related field.

Troubleshooting: Identify and fix issues with devices, using diagnostic tools and software
Troubleshooting and problem-solving are key aspects of the role of an electrical and electronic repairer. These professionals are responsible for fixing and maintaining complex electrical and electronic equipment. They must be adept at identifying issues and implementing effective solutions.
To achieve this, repairers use a combination of software programs and testing equipment. Software is particularly useful for diagnosing malfunctions in automated electronic control systems, which are becoming increasingly complex. Various diagnostic tools are available, such as multimeters, which can measure voltage, current, and resistance. More advanced multimeters can also measure the capacitance, inductance, and current gain of transistors.
Beyond software, electrical and electronic repairers also rely on standard tools for manual repairs, such as pliers, screwdrivers, and wrenches. They may also work on the calibration of equipment and perform tests to assess the performance of electronic systems or devices. If issues are identified, repairers must decide whether to repair or replace the necessary components.

Administrative tasks: Keep records of repairs, time taken, and parts used
Electrical and electronic repairers are responsible for a long list of duties, including administrative tasks such as record-keeping. Accurate and detailed record-keeping is essential in this field, as it helps ensure proper documentation of repairs, optimises future repair processes, and provides valuable information for other technicians who may work on similar projects.
Records of repairs should include detailed information about the specific issue, the steps taken to diagnose and address it, and any changes made to the product. This documentation should be clear and comprehensive, allowing other technicians to understand the work performed and facilitating any future repairs or adjustments.
It is also important to record the time taken for each repair. This information can help repairers improve their efficiency by identifying areas where they can streamline their processes. Additionally, tracking time can provide valuable data for estimating repair durations, which is useful for both the repairer and their clients.
Recording the parts used in repairs is another critical aspect of administrative tasks. This record-keeping helps with inventory management, ensuring that commonly used parts are always in stock and readily available. It also aids in identifying less frequently used parts that may need to be special-ordered or sourced from alternative suppliers.
Finally, keeping organised records of all these details enables electrical and electronic repairers to provide accurate documentation to their clients or employers. This documentation can be used for billing purposes, warranty information, or even as a reference for future repairs on similar equipment.
